The Anatomy of the Ache

Most of the time, the pain comes from one of three places: your toes, your arches, or your heels.

If your toes are feeling crushed, it’s usually a sizing or lacing issue. If your arches are screaming, it’s likely a support problem. And if your heels are rubbing or feeling heavy, you’re probably dealing with a fit issue that’s causing friction Easy to understand, harder to ignore..

The Foundation: Socks and Liners

I know it sounds simple, but your socks are the most important piece of gear you own.

One of the biggest mistakes I see is people wearing thick, woolly hiking socks. In practice, don't do that. Which means it sounds counterintuitive, but thick socks actually kill your warmth. They take up too much volume inside the boot, which restricts blood flow and makes your feet colder.

Instead, you want a thin, moisture-wicking technical snowboard sock. You want something that moves moisture away from your skin and stays relatively thin to allow for a snug, but not tight, fit Easy to understand, harder to ignore..

The Shell: Boot Fit and Volume

Your boots are the most expensive part of your kit, so you need to get them right. There are two types of fit: volume and wrap Still holds up..

Volume is the space inside the boot. If your boots are too small for your foot volume, you're going to have constant pressure on the top of your toes. But wrap is how the boot hugs your foot. You want a "snug" wrap—meaning there's no heel lift when you move—but you don't want it so tight that it cuts off circulation.

If you have a "high volume" foot, you might need a different brand. Some brands are built for narrower feet, while others offer more room in the toe box.

The Connection: Bindings and Plate Pressure

Sometimes the problem isn't the boot; it's the interface Worth keeping that in mind..

If your bindings aren't sitting flat on your board, or if your boots are shifting around inside the bindings, you're going to experience uneven pressure. This can cause "hot spots" on the bottom of your feet.

Check your baseplate. On top of that, if it’s old or worn, it might not be providing the even distribution of weight you need. Also, make sure your straps are tightened evenly. If one strap is pulling significantly harder than the other, you're going to feel it in your arches Nothing fancy..

Practical Tips / What Actually Works

If you're currently dealing with foot pain, here is my "real talk" checklist for fixing it.

  • Don't wear cotton. Ever. Cotton stays wet. Wet feet get cold. Cold feet swell.
  • Invest in custom footbeds. Most boots come with cheap, flimsy foam insoles. They provide zero arch support. A custom footbed (or even a high-quality aftermarket one) can change your life. It redistributes the pressure across your whole foot.
  • The "Warm-Up" trick. Before you head out, get your blood flowing. Do some toe curls or calf raises. It sounds silly, but it helps prepare your feet for the cold.
  • Check your toe-cap. If you feel a sharp pain on the top of your toes, your boots might be too low-volume. You might need a boot with a higher "toe box."
  • Loosen up at lunch. If you feel the ache starting, don't wait until you're in agony. Take your boots off for ten minutes while you eat. Let the blood flow return.

FAQ

Why are my toes numb but my feet are warm?

This is usually a sign of compression. You likely have your laces or straps too tight, or your boots are too narrow. The pressure is pinching the nerves or restricting blood flow specifically in the toe area And it works..

Should I wear thicker socks if my feet are cold?

No. As mentioned before, thicker socks take up too much room and actually make your feet colder by preventing circulation. Stick to thin, high-quality technical socks.

How do I know if my boots are too small?

If you feel your toes hitting the front of the boot while you are walking (not just riding), they are too small. You should have a tiny bit of wiggle room in your toes when you are standing still Nothing fancy..
